There is nowhere quite like the Little Museum of Dublin. With a collection created by public donation, and a sincere commitment to having fun, we are truly a people’s museum of the Irish capital.
Our famous 29-minute guided tours are a celebration of great Irish storytelling. In addition to the tour there are a multitude of additional fascinating exhibits to explore.
You will learn about our history, laugh a lot and meet some of the most charming people in the world's friendliest city. The museum is located in a stunning Georgian Townhouse at 15 St. Stephen's Green, right in the heart of the city.

The Little Museum of Dublin, 15. St. Stephen's Green, Dublin 2, D02Y066 You will join a guided tour that is fast becoming known as one of the best examples of its kind in Europe. On our famous guided tours, our brilliant ambassadors tell stories that are universal, emotional and hilarious. This is a world-class museum of the Irish capital that captures and reflects the history, hospitality and humour of Dublin itself, showcasing a collection of artefacts, largely donated by the people of the city. The museum is also home to Tara's Palace, one of the world's largest dolls houses, and a room dedicated to Dublin rock band, U2.
